Yard fertilization is a targeted technique to feeding turfgrass with the nutrients it requires to remain thick, green, and resilient. Nitrogen is the most essential nutrient for promoting leaf development, while phosphorus supports root development and potassium enhances stress tolerance. The ideal mix and application schedule depend upon grass type, soil test results, and seasonal requirements. Fertilization can be applied through slow-release items for constant growth or quick-release choices for rapid green-up. Timing is vital-- cool-season yards gain from fall and spring feedings, while warm-season lawns respond best to summertime applications. Constant yard fertilization supports not only visual appeal but also the lawn's ability to withstand weeds, illness, and ecological stress.
